Protesters condemn Houthi execution orders against abductees

September Net
A number of protesters staged a rally in Marib today to condemn the Houthi execution orders against peaceful oppositionists in the militia’s captivity in the capital Sana’a.
The sentenced captives are activists, politicians and academicians.
In a statement, the protesters including representatives from 18 civil society organizations deplored in the strongest terms the execution orders against the activists who had been subject to torture in the militia’s jails for years.
They called on the UN Security Council, the UN Human Rights Council and the UN Special Envoy to Yemen to stop these orders and to bear their responsibility in preserving the rights of the abductees who, according to the latest (Stockholm) peace deal, should be freed.
